Why Leaders Need to Master Difficult Conversations

Leaders often avoid difficult conversations because they fear damaging relationships or creating conflict. However, avoiding these situations can do more harm than good. Unresolved issues can fester, leading to:

  • Decreased trust and morale
  • Lower performance
  • Misalignment with company goals
  • Increased tension and resentment

Approaching tough conversations with clarity and purpose ensures that problems are addressed early and solutions are found. When done well, these conversations can actually strengthen relationships and drive better results.

How to Lead Difficult Conversations with Confidence

  1. Prepare Thoroughly: Before initiating the conversation, take the time to gather your thoughts and facts. Understand the issue clearly, so you can articulate it without ambiguity. Preparation builds confidence and ensures you stay focused on the topic.
  2. Set the Right Tone: Approach the conversation with empathy and a problem-solving mindset. It’s important to remember that the goal isn’t to “win” but to create a solution. Starting the conversation with an open mind and a willingness to listen will set the right tone.
  3. Be Direct but Kind: Get to the point, but don’t forget to be compassionate. Address the issue head-on, but always show respect for the individual. The key is to balance honesty with empathy.
  4. Focus on the Future: Instead of dwelling on past mistakes, guide the conversation towards future actions. What can be done to improve the situation? How can both parties work together to resolve the issue? Shifting the focus to solutions fosters a positive outlook.
  5. Follow Up: After the conversation, make sure to follow up on the agreed-upon actions. This demonstrates your commitment to resolving the issue and reinforces accountability within the team.
